EV charging in El Centro, CA

Here is what NREL's public data shows about EV charging in El Centro, CA. As of NREL AFDC data retrieved June 2026, El Centro has 9 public charging stations with 12 Level 2 ports, including 70 DC fast-charging ports for quick top-ups.

Stations are operated across 7 networks: Tesla (3), Non-networked (1), Electrify America (1), EVRANGE (1), and 3 more.

Connectors on record: NACS / Tesla at 3 stations; J1772 (Level 2) at 3 stations; CCS (J1772 Combo) at 3 stations; CHAdeMO at 1 station.

Of these stations, 1 list free charging, per NREL's pricing field. Pricing is not recorded for the remaining 8. Always confirm current pricing with the network before you charge.

3 stations carry a NACS / Tesla connector — relevant if you drive a Tesla or a newer EV that has switched to NACS.

What this means

Level 2 is the standard public and home charger (240V) — a few hours for a full charge, fine for shopping, work, or overnight. DC fast charging is the highway kind: 20–40 minutes to most of a charge, but not every station has it.

Connectors are the plug shape. J1772 is the universal Level 2 plug almost every non-Tesla EV uses. CCS and CHAdeMO are DC fast-charging plugs (CHAdeMO is older, mostly older Nissan Leafs). NACS is Tesla's plug, now the emerging US standard — many newer non-Teslas use it or an adapter.

This page summarizes NREL's own station records and is not a live availability map — a charger listed here can still be busy, broken, or behind a gate. Check the network's app before you rely on a specific plug.
